What is this? A food supplement sold in Belgium and the UK contains an herb called Artemisia annua. This herb is not approved for use in food in the EU.

What's happening? The product was found to have this unauthorised herb. Authorities are checking if it poses any risk.

Does this affect me? If you bought or used this supplement in Belgium or the UK, it may affect you.

What should I do? Stop using the supplement and ask your pharmacist or doctor for advice.
